Abstract
A system for preparing digital device simulation models ranging in complexity from SSI and LSI is presented. The evolution of a new language that simplifies model development especially for LSI chips is described. The integration of this language into LASAR, a widely used board simulator and pattern regenerator, is illustrated together with examples.
